Abstract
It the utility model is related to a kind of flatness detecting device of cell phone rear cover, rack, horizontal guide rail and detection device are provided with the rack, the detection device is located above horizontal guide rail, the fixed disk of fixed cell phone rear cover is provided with horizontal guide rail, fixed disk moves on horizontal guide rail, the fixed disk is uniformly arranged on horizontal guide rail, the detection device includes rack-mounted cover body, laser emitter in cover body, alarm and controller on cover body, the controller and laser emitter, alarm is electrically connected, the laser emitter is located above guide rail.The utility model accuracy of detection is high, using laser detection mode, there is provided the accuracy of detection is, it can be achieved that the automatic detection of cell phone rear cover flatness.

Embodiment
To enable the above-mentioned purpose of the utility model, feature and advantage more obvious understandable, below in conjunction with the accompanying drawings to this
The embodiment of utility model is described in detail.
Referring to Fig. 1, a kind of flatness detecting device of cell phone rear cover, including:Rack 1, is provided with level in rack 1 and leads
Rail 2 and detection device 3, detection device 3 are located at the top of horizontal guide rail 2, consolidating for fixed cell phone rear cover are provided with horizontal guide rail 2
Price fixing 11, fixed disk 11 move on horizontal guide rail 2, and fixed disk 11 is uniformly arranged on horizontal guide rail 2.Cell phone rear cover is placed
In on fixed disk 11, fixed disk moves on horizontal guide rail 2, and then the fixed disk with cell phone rear cover is moved to detection device
3 tops, are detected the flatness of cell phone rear cover.
In the present embodiment, the cover body 31 that detection device 3 includes being installed in rack 1, the laser hair in cover body 31
Emitter 32, alarm 33 and controller on cover body 31, controller are electrically connected with laser emitter 32, alarm 33,
Laser emitter 32 is located at the top of horizontal guide rail 2.
During detection, cell phone rear cover to be detected is positioned over fixed disk 11, and controller control fixed disk 11 moves to laser hair
The lower section of emitter 32, laser emitter 32 start detection the distance between laser emitter 32 and cell phone rear cover, are set on controller
There is setting range, if the distance value in setting range, illustrates that cell phone rear cover is smooth, then detection is qualified, if not in setting range
It is interior, illustrate that cell phone rear cover flatness is poor, then unqualified, alarm equipment alarm.Detected using laser emitter, accuracy of detection is high.
Alarm uses audible-visual annunciator.The shape of fixed disk and the shape of cell phone rear cover are adapted.
In the present embodiment, the driving motor in cycle movement is connected with horizontal guide rail 2, driving is solid every time for driving motor
The distance of price fixing movement is equal to the centre distance between two neighboring fixed disk.In this way, different fixed disks stops every time
When, can be just in test station, i.e., below laser emitter 32.
In the present embodiment, cover body 31 includes the side plate 41 being connected with rack 1 and the top plate 42 being connected with side plate, and top plate is located at
Above horizontal guide rail 2, sliding slot is provided with 42 bottom surface of top plate, laser emitter 32 is slidably connected with top plate 42, controller control
Laser emitter 32 slides on the chute.In this way, laser emitter 32 can detect more multipoint distance on cell phone rear cover,
And compared with preset range, so as to judge whether cell phone rear cover is qualified.Cell phone rear cover is horizontality, ensures the accurate of detection
Property.
